Recommended place to stay:
This swanky five-star has a rarefied position on luxury shopping avenue Passeig de Gràcia, near Gaudí’s Pedrera and Casa Battlo and the city’s chicest boutiques. Contemporary styled rooms with oak floors and floor-to-ceiling windows are filled with light.
Designer Patricia Urquiola’s interiors are spectacular, from the white-and-gold atrium to the white-on-white bedrooms. The two-bedroom Penthouse Suite occupies the entire eighth floor with wrap-around terraces.
The Michelin two-starred restaurant Moments has a fantastically creative Catalan menu, there’s an all-day brasserie or you could go for drinks and nibbles in the tranquil Mimosa Garden. The rooftop terrace, complete with plunge pool is perfect for a sunset cocktail, or dinner at Terrata, serving inventive Peruvian.
To top it all off there’s a fabulous spa, with a lap pool and fitness centre, and the best concierge service in town.
